About the business
As a family childcare provider for 31 years, my goal is to provide a safe and happy environment for each child that will stimulate their physical, intellectual, social and emotional growth at their own pace. I offer loving care that focuses on each child as a unique and wonderful individual which builds self-esteem and respect for others. As a partner in caring for your child, my interaction with you is as important as my interaction with your child.
We care about each child individually, striving not to compare, but to appreciate the precious rhythm of each ones growth. We do not in any way attempt to replace the priority of the home and its environment, but rather seek to supplement and enrich your childs experience. We feel that each child needs to develop intellectually, socially, and physically, therefore your child will be exposed to many songs, stories, poems, games, large and small muscle equipment and a variety of other activities.
Infants are provided with a safe environment in which to explore a variety of age-appropriate materials, consistent responses, environments, and routines. While supporting their temperament, learning style, and interests. Helping them form secure relationship with the provider.
Children will have access to various age-appropriate activities throughout the day. Some of the activities your child will participate in are: assorted building blocks and other construction materials; imaginary play, picture books, paints and other art materials, table toys such as matching games, pegboards and puzzles. The children will be introduced to numbers and the alphabet in the context of their everyday experiences in addition to learning how to hold a pencil or crayon.
Learning observation skills during our walks and outside play. Additional activities like cooking and serving snack will provide a basis for physics and math. We strive to learn self regulation along with sharing, taking turns, listening to and following directions and cooperating within a group setting. While helping your toddler focus on becoming more independent as he or she grows. Basic skills such as potty training, dressing, and communicating using their words. The children are exposed to basic concepts like shapes, letters, colors, early sight words, animal identification and counting along with number recognition, feeling words and more. Pre-school age children will work with more advanced math, language, and science concepts, as well as paying attention.
